K9 & Company was indeed a pilot for a children's show, but due to low
ratings,it never got more shows made. It's still a novelty in that it's the
only show to follow the "further adventures" of a companion, so it's sort
of a Dr. Who staple (like the two movies). No, the Dr. didn't show up in that
show (so he didn't show up in the "series").
JNT says K9 will *never*, ever return to the set of Doctor Who. He said:
"Since we were the first show to introduce a cutesy robot dog, I figured
we should be the first to get rid of one. And, no, I will never bring back
the mangy mechanical mutt. Never."
He says, though, the the Sonic Screwdriver may make a comeback next season
(next in England, that is).
